Artist description:
Caustic, erratic, unorthodox music that is loosely tied to a scene people once knew as "Punk Rock." But now, Avril Lavigne is Punk so we are Pop, I guess since we are the oposite of her.
Music Style:
Punk Rock... the atypical kind. You know those weird songs on all the Punk albums in the 80s (Fear - "We Destroy the Family", Dayglo Abortions - "Black Sabbath", Rudimentary Peni - "Vampire State Building", Black Flag - "Black Love", Angry Samoans - "They Saved Hitler's Cock")? There were always 2-4 of them per album. We are influenced by those songs, not the other 7-12. We are also influenced by the 1-3 really revved up, punky songs that you can find on the New Wave albums of the late 70s (Joe Jackson - "Got the Time", DEVO - "Be Stiff", Blondie - "Youth Nabbed as Sniper", XTC - "Chain of Command", Ultravox - "Young Savage").
I guess you could call us Post-Hardcore, but we're really more Post-Post-Hardcore, or post-hardcore Post-Punk, or Artcore, if you will.
